Step-by-Step Instructions

Prepare Your Oven and Dish:
Preheat your oven to 375°F ensuring it reaches the proper temperature for even cooking. Thoroughly grease your 9x13 baking dish making sure to coat the sides to prevent sticking. I prefer using a glass baking dish as it allows you to see when the sides are bubbling properly.
Create the Creamy Base:
In a large mixing bowl combine the cream of chicken soup sour cream ranch dressing garlic powder and black pepper. Whisk until completely smooth with no lumps remaining. This creates the flavorful foundation that will infuse the entire casserole. Fold in your shredded chicken and half the bacon gently incorporating them throughout the mixture.
Layer the Components:
Spread the chicken mixture evenly across the bottom of your greased baking dish using a spatula to create a level base. Next sprinkle the first portion of cheeses evenly over the chicken layer. This middle cheese layer melts into the chicken creating pockets of gooey goodness.
Arrange the Tater Tots:
Place your frozen tater tots in a single layer across the top of the casserole. For maximum crispiness avoid overlapping them too much. The organized pattern not only looks appealing but ensures even cooking. Finish by sprinkling the remaining cheese and bacon pieces evenly over the tots.
Bake to Golden Perfection:
Bake the casserole uncovered for 40 to 45 minutes. You'll know it's done when the tater tots turn deeply golden brown and crispy and you can see the edges bubbling vigorously. The cheese should be completely melted with some delicious browned spots on top.
Rest and Garnish:
Allow the finished casserole to rest for 5 minutes after removing from the oven. This resting period helps the layers set making it easier to serve clean portions. Just before serving sprinkle fresh chopped parsley across the top adding a pop of color and fresh flavor.

Make-Ahead Instructions

This casserole was designed with busy families in mind. You can prepare the entire dish up to the baking stage cover it tightly with plastic wrap then refrigerate for up to 24 hours. When ready to cook simply remove from the refrigerator while preheating your oven then add about 5 to 10 minutes to the baking time since you're starting with cold ingredients. For longer storage assemble the casserole freeze it unbaked then thaw overnight in the refrigerator before cooking as directed.

Common Queries

→ Can I use a different type of cheese?

Yes, you can substitute cheddar and mozzarella with your favorite blends, such as Monterey Jack or Colby, to suit your taste.

→ Is it possible to use leftover chicken?

Absolutely! Rotisserie or any cooked, shredded chicken pairs well and saves prep time for this casserole.

→ Can this dish be prepared ahead of time?

You can assemble the layers a day ahead, refrigerate covered, and bake when ready. Allow extra baking time if chilled.

→ How do I achieve extra crispy tater tots?

Arrange tater tots in a single layer and ensure the topping remains uncovered while baking for maximum crispness.

→ Are there alternatives to bacon?

For a pork-free version, try turkey bacon or omit entirely; consider adding sautéed mushrooms for a savory bite.

→ Can I freeze leftovers?

Yes, allow the casserole to cool, portion, and freeze in airtight containers for up to two months. Reheat until piping hot.

What You’ll Need

01 32 oz frozen tater tots
02 2 cups cooked shredded chicken
03 1.5 cups shredded cheddar cheese
04 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
05 6 slices bacon, cooked and crumbled
06 10.5 oz can cream of chicken soup
07 0.5 cup sour cream
08 0.5 cup ranch dressing
09 1 tsp garlic powder
10 0.25 tsp black pepper
11 1 tbsp chopped fresh parsley

Steps to Follow

Step 01

Preheat your oven to 190°C (375°F). Grease a 9x13-inch baking dish with oil or cooking spray.

Step 02

In a large bowl, mix together the cream of chicken soup, sour cream, ranch dressing, garlic powder, and black pepper until smooth. Stir in the shredded chicken and half of the crumbled bacon.

Step 03

Spread the creamy chicken mixture evenly into the bottom of the baking dish. Sprinkle with 1 cup of cheddar cheese and 0.5 cup of mozzarella cheese.

Step 04

Arrange the frozen tater tots in a single layer over the chicken mixture. Sprinkle the remaining cheese and crumbled bacon evenly over the top.

Step 05

Bake uncovered in the preheated oven for 40–45 minutes, or until the tater tots are golden and crispy and the casserole is bubbling.

Step 06

Remove the casserole from the oven and let it rest for 5 minutes. Sprinkle the top with chopped fresh parsley before serving. Serve hot.
